Output 801dd91e805767284a7ab152045378193b01fef6c8d354c69081f8a42d91e757:10

value
5716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485661334b43bd0f4f5d538d1d348d976e3e2383 OP_EQUAL
address
38HW4819NE7nY2APTBCL14y89BV21J72L3
transaction
801dd91e805767284a7ab152045378193b01fef6c8d354c69081f8a42d91e757
spent
true